

Clinical Interns
Our clinical interns are Master’s Level Counseling Students who have completed the two-year academic requirements of their graduate training and are prepared to provide therapy as part of their field training.
Our clinical interns are supervised by a professionally licensed and established counselor at Reflections and receive quality guidance and feedback to ensure a high level of care for our clients.
Appointments with our clinical interns are offered at a reduced session rate providing an affordable way to access quality mental health care. For more information, or to schedule with a clinical intern, please click below.
Meet our Interns
Heaven Davis
Masters Level Intern
Hi, I’m Heaven Davis.
​
I am currently completing my Master’s degree in Mental Health Counseling at Walden University, and I also hold a Master’s degree in Applied Behavioral Analysis along with a Bachelor’s degree in Therapeutic Recreation.
I have over 10 years of experience working in both outpatient and inpatient mental health settings, where I’ve supported individuals through a wide range of challenges.
​
My background in Applied Behavioral Analysis allows me to help clients better understand patterns in their thoughts and behaviors, build practical coping skills, and work toward meaningful, lasting change.
I believe therapy is a collaborative process, and I strive to create a supportive, nonjudgmental space where clients feel heard and empowered.
